King's Awards for Enterprise 2023 - read about all the West Midlands winners

A vitamin product manufacturer and natural pet food company are among ten recipients from across the region to win a 2023 award

Ten companies from across the West Midlands have been recognised with a King's Award for Enterprise today(Image: Victoria Jones/AP/REX/Shutterstock)

A vitamin product manufacturer, chamber of commerce and natural pet food company are among West Midlands businesses which have been handed a King's Award for Enterprise today.

Rem3dy Health, Staffordshire Chamber and First Class Pet Company are among a group of ten companies from across the region which have won the coveted accolade (see full list below).

Now in its 57th year, The King's Awards recognises business excellence across four different categories - international trade, innovation, sustainable development and promoting opportunity - with recipients permitted to fly the King's Awards flag at their main office and use the emblem on marketing material for five years.

Across the º£½ÇÊÓÆµ, 148 businesses have received the honour this year. 2023 marks the first time in the history of the awards that they will bear the King's name following the death of Queen Elizabeth II in September.

His Majesty's Lord Lieutenants will be presenting the awards to businesses locally throughout the year.
